大家好,最近互联网行业的热搜让人揪心,引起大家对身体健康的重视的同时,很多人有了逃离大厂的想法。 那除了大厂,一向以注重 “life work balance” 的外企似乎也是不错的选择。 小编特意询问了曾在外企做过几年程序员的朋友,今天分享下外企的工作经历,也准备了几份外企的面经,有 Ebay、Shopee 等公司,想要进外企的小伙伴,可以关注公众号…
在 Spring Boot 开发过程中,我们经常会看到使用 @EnableXXX 来激活我们某一个功能性的模块,通过类注解激活后我们就能使用所激活的配置给我们带来的功能。 今天我们就来探究一下这个 @EnableXXX 给我们做了哪些工作,或者我们应该怎么通过自定义的方式开发我们自己的功能模块。 演示环境 IntelliJ IDEA 2020.2.1…
1.概述 CompletableFuture是jdk1.8引入的实现类。扩展了Future和CompletionStage,是一个可以在任务完成阶段触发一些操作Future。 简单的来讲就是可以实现异步回调。 2.为什么引入CompletableFuture…
昨天,在发布了 《Spring官宣承认网传大漏洞,并提供解决方案》 之后。群里( 点击加群 )就有几个小伙伴问了这样的问题: 我们的Spring版本比较老,这个怎么办? 这是一个好问题,所以DD今天单独拿出来说说。 这次的RCE漏洞宣布之后,官方给出的主要解决方案是升级版本,但只有Spring 5.2、5.3和Spring Boot…
今天给大家分享一本好书:周志明老师的 《凤凰架构:构建可靠的大型分布式系统》,文末附电子版地址。 周志明是谁? 这可是真大佬,或许有些朋友没有听过,但是你们一定听过:《深入理解 Java…
一般update tbl set money=money-100 where id=1 and money=1000 是不是就能保证没有并发问题了?